汽车故障诊断协议源代码包及控制系统解析

版权申诉
5星 · 超过95%的资源 2 下载量 167 浏览量 更新于2024-10-03 收藏 9.12MB RAR 举报
资源摘要信息:"汽车故障诊断协议 TL718、大众KWP1281、Kwp2000 和 ISO15765 是现代汽车诊断领域中的关键元素。本资源包提供了相关的诊断源代码,特别是使用VC++ 6.0编写的版本,涉及对控制电脑的全面诊断能力。了解这些技术将对汽车维修和电子系统的故障诊断带来极大帮助。 1. **TL718**: TL718是汽车诊断协议中的一部分,它涉及到车辆的通信与数据交换。此类协议允许诊断工具与车辆的电子控制单元(ECU)进行有效沟通。了解TL718可以帮助技术人员识别和解决汽车电子系统中出现的问题。 2. **大众KWP1281和Kwp2000**: KWP1281和Kwp2000是指ISO 14230-3中定义的两种诊断通信协议,它们广泛应用于大众汽车集团的车辆。KWP1281是关键字协议(KWP)的一部分,它定义了车辆与诊断设备之间进行通信时应遵循的规则。KWP2000是KWP1281的扩展,它涵盖了更加复杂和详细的诊断需求。了解这些协议对于进行大众车型的故障诊断至关重要。 3. **ISO15765**: ISO15765是国际标准化组织(ISO)制定的车辆诊断协议,它规定了车辆诊断通信的方式和格式。这个协议主要基于CAN网络,广泛应用于现代车辆的网络通信。ISO15765协议包括了车辆数据的请求和传输的规范,以及错误诊断的处理。 4. **VC++ 6.0源代码包**: 资源包中包含的VC++ 6.0源代码用于在诊断工具或系统中实施上述协议。VC++是微软公司开发的一种面向对象的编程语言,具有高效性、灵活性等特点。源代码包包括了用于诊断大众汽车电子控制单元的程序代码,这些代码可以帮助开发者或技术人员创建适用于多种大众车型的诊断软件。 5. **控制电脑的诊断**: 汽车的控制电脑即ECU,是车辆中负责处理发动机、传动系统和车辆控制等电子设备的中心。ECU的故障会直接影响到车辆的性能和安全。通过使用本资源包中的诊断协议和源代码,维修人员可以有效地对ECU进行故障分析和修复,确保车辆稳定运行。 6. **汽车电气系统诊断**: 汽车电气系统包含了多个复杂的子系统,如发动机管理系统、ABS系统、安全气囊系统等。掌握如何利用TL718、KWP1281、Kwp2000和ISO15765等协议进行电气系统诊断,能够帮助技术人员高效地定位和解决问题。 总结来说,本资源包整合了汽车诊断的核心协议和技术,提供了针对大众车型的详细诊断方法。掌握这些知识对于汽车维修人员、工程师和技术爱好者来说至关重要,它能显著提升他们解决汽车电气系统故障的能力。"